Transaction 3abf78ddef5ec23c856f1949e4544801659a02836a69ff4882b687c44e24cd18
1 Input
1 Output
-
3abf78ddef5ec23c856f1949e4544801659a02836a69ff4882b687c44e24cd18:0
- value
- 26384647
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a61fb52ba7e28139e214fe0ae130c23510bbe70 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19EuC9ydK4tZvaR6UuyGhssNdA9CMAC2PL